Understanding the Roblox Ban System: Types of Bans and Their Severity

Before we delve into the unbanning process, it’s crucial to understand the different types of bans Roblox issues. This knowledge is vital because the severity of the ban directly impacts your chances of getting your account back.

Temporary Bans

Temporary bans are, as the name suggests, short-term suspensions. These are typically issued for less severe offenses, such as:

  • Minor violations of the Roblox Community Rules: This might include inappropriate chat, mild harassment, or using offensive language.
  • Repeated minor offenses: Accumulating several minor infractions can lead to a temporary ban.
  • Exploiting minor bugs: Using glitches for an unfair advantage may result in a temporary ban.

The duration of a temporary ban can vary, ranging from a few hours to a few days, or even a week or two. The good news is that temporary bans usually expire automatically, and your account will be reinstated after the suspension period.

Permanent Bans

Permanent bans, also known as account terminations, are much more serious. They are typically issued for severe violations of the Roblox Community Rules and Terms of Service. These can include:

  • Severe Harassment and Bullying: Targeting other users with malicious intent.
  • Hate Speech and Discrimination: Using language that promotes hatred or prejudice against individuals or groups.
  • Exploiting Major Bugs and Cheating: Using hacks, bots, or other methods to gain an unfair advantage or compromise the integrity of the platform.
  • Creating or Sharing Inappropriate Content: This includes content that is sexually suggestive, violent, or otherwise violates Roblox’s content guidelines.
  • Account Security Breaches: This includes sharing account information, or attempts to phish for other users information.

Permanent bans are, as the name implies, permanent. Getting a permanent ban reversed is significantly more difficult, but not always impossible.

The Roblox Appeal Process: Your Path to Unbanning (Potentially)

If you believe your ban was unfair or resulted from a misunderstanding, you have the right to appeal. This is your primary avenue for attempting to have your account reinstated.

Where to Submit Your Appeal

The primary method for appealing a ban is through the Roblox Support website. Here’s how to do it:

  1. Go to the Roblox Support page: Navigate to the official Roblox Support website.
  2. Locate the “Contact Us” section: Usually, there’s a contact form or a section dedicated to submitting support requests.
  3. Select the appropriate category: Choose the category that best describes your issue, such as “Account Issues” or “Ban Appeal.”
  4. Fill out the form accurately: Provide all the required information, including your username, email address associated with your account, and a detailed explanation of why you believe the ban should be lifted.

Crafting a Compelling Appeal: Tips for Success

Your appeal is your chance to make your case. A well-written appeal significantly increases your chances of success. Here are some tips:

  • Be honest and transparent: Acknowledge any wrongdoing, even if it was unintentional.
  • Be polite and respectful: Maintain a professional tone throughout your appeal.
  • Provide a clear explanation: Explain why you believe the ban was unjust or resulted from a misunderstanding.
  • Offer context: If applicable, provide context to help Roblox understand the situation better.
  • Take responsibility: If you made a mistake, take responsibility for your actions and express your remorse.
  • Promise to abide by the rules: Reiterate your commitment to following the Roblox Community Rules and Terms of Service in the future.

What to Avoid in Your Appeal

There are certain things that can hurt your chances of getting unbanned. Avoid these pitfalls:

  • Being rude or aggressive: This will likely get your appeal ignored.
  • Lying or making excuses: Roblox moderators can often verify the facts.
  • Blaming others: Take responsibility for your actions.
  • Sending multiple appeals: This can be counterproductive. Wait for a response to your initial appeal before sending another one.

Understanding the Waiting Game: How Long Does it Take to Get Unbanned?

The timeframe for a response to your appeal can vary. There is no guaranteed timeframe, but a common waiting period is anywhere from a few days to a few weeks.

Factors Influencing Response Time

Several factors can influence how long it takes to receive a response:

  • The volume of support requests: Roblox receives a massive number of support requests daily.
  • The complexity of your case: More complex cases may require more investigation.
  • The accuracy and completeness of your appeal: A well-written and detailed appeal can speed up the process.

What to Do While You Wait

While you’re waiting for a response, there are a few things you can do:

  • Be patient: Avoid sending multiple appeals, as this can slow down the process.
  • Check your email regularly: Roblox will likely contact you via the email address associated with your account.
  • Refrain from violating the rules: Avoid doing anything that could result in further disciplinary action.

FAQs About Roblox Bans

Here are some frequently asked questions about Roblox bans that are not addressed in the headings above:

Why does it take so long to get a response from Roblox Support? Roblox Support receives a massive volume of requests daily, leading to potential delays in processing appeals and inquiries. Additionally, complex cases may require additional investigation, further prolonging the response time.

What happens if I get banned again after being unbanned? If you are unbanned and subsequently violate the Roblox Community Rules again, you may face a more severe penalty, potentially including a permanent ban. Repeated violations demonstrate a disregard for the platform’s guidelines.

Can I use a VPN to bypass a Roblox ban? Using a VPN to circumvent a ban is a violation of the Roblox Terms of Service. Roblox can detect VPN usage, and doing so could lead to further disciplinary action.

Is there any way to get a refund for purchases made on a banned account? Unfortunately, it is very unlikely that you will get a refund for purchases made on a banned account. Roblox’s terms of service generally do not provide for refunds in these situations, particularly when the ban results from a violation of the rules.

Does Roblox have a system for appealing permanent bans that is more lenient than the support form? The Roblox Support website is the primary avenue for appealing a ban, including permanent bans. There is no separate, more lenient system.
